| <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> |
| <html dir="rtl"> |
| <head> |
| <title>מקורות NetBeans</title> |
| <meta name="description" content="Info about the NetBeans sources - how to get them, what is here ..."> |
| <meta http-equiv="Content-Type" content="text/html; charset=UTF-8"> |
| <link rel="stylesheet" type="text/css" href="../../netbeans.css"> |
| <meta http-equiv="content-language" content="he"> |
| </head> |
| <body> |
| <h1>המקורות</h1> |
| <br> |
| קוד המקור של The NetBeans זמין במסגרת |
| <a href="../../about/legal/license.html">Common Development and Distribution License</a> (CDDL). |
| <p>קוד המקור זמין במאגר Mercurial. כל הפיתוח של NetBeans מתבצע באמצעות שרת Mercurial באתר זה, ואילו הצעות פיתוח והחלטות נעשות |
| <a href="../lists/index_he.html">ברשימות דיוור ציבוריות</a>. |
| </p> |
| <p>ניתן לקבל את המקור במספר דרכים. |
| </p> |
| <ul> |
| <li>באמצעות Mercurial - לקבלת פרטים, עיין ב<a href="hg.html">דף ה-Mercurial</a>;</li> |
| <li>הורד תצלום הנמצא בארכיון <a |
| href="../../downloads/index.html">מדף ההורדות</a>;</li> |
| <li><a href="http://hg.netbeans.org/main/file/">עיון מקוון</a></li> |
| </ul> |
| <p>אם את מעוניין ליצור build מקוד מקור, עיין ב<a href="http://wiki.netbeans.org/WorkingWithNetBeansSources">דפי הבנייה/התקנה</a>. |
| </p> |
| <h2>אז מה יש כאן?</h2> |
| <br> |
| זמינים כאן כל עץ המקור וההיסטוריה של NetBeans IDE. באופן כללי, קיים הענף "היציב" ו"ענף הפיתוח". ענף הפיתוח הוא המקום שבו מתבצע הפיתוח השוטף - הוא יהיה יציב פחות או יותר, בהתאם לנקודה שבה הוא נמצא במחזור המהדורה. |
| <p>לקבלת תיאור של הארגון הפיזי של המקור במאגר ה-Mercurial, עיין במסמך <a href="structure.html">ענפי ותוויות Mercurial</a>. |
| </p> |
| <h2><a name="extbins">האם מה שנמצא כאן הוא המקור המלא? האם יש משהו שלא נמצא כאן?</a></h2> |
| <br> |
| קיימים מספר דברים שלא נמצאים כאן בשל סיבות משפטיות. קיימים מספר חלקים של ה- NetBeans IDE שהם תוכנה של צד שלישי או כפופים לרישיון שאינו מאפשר להפוך את המקור שלהם לנחלת הכלל כאן. |
| <p>דוגמאות לפריטים מסוג זה כוללות: |
| </p> |
| <ul> |
| <li><b>Java Compiler</b> - תוכנית הניתוח של Java ב-NetBeans היא מעטפת סביב הקומפיילר של שפת Java (javac). מקורות javac זמינים במסגרת רישיון GPL v2 ב<a href="http://openjdk.dev.java.net/">אתרOpenJDK</a>. NB 5.x וגרסאות מוקדמות יותר משתמשות בגרסה קודמת של קומפיילר javac הזמין בכפוף לרישיון מגביל יותר של Sun BCL.<br> |
| </li> |
| <li><b>תוכניות ניתוח XML </b>(Xerces, Crimson, Xalan, DOM, SAX, JAXP, ...) - המשמשות בכל ה-IDE לניתוח ניתוח והפעלת XML. <a href="http://java.sun.com/xml/">http://java.sun.com/xml/</a> |
| </li> |
| <li><b>JavaHelp Runtime library 2.x</b> - ה-IDE משתמש ב-JavaHelp כדי להציג תיעוד מקוון. גם הפצת הקבצים הבינאריים הנוספים עשויה לכלול את ספריית זמן הפיתוח של JavaHelp כדי לבנות מחדש מסדי נתונים לחיפוש. <a |
| href="http://java.sun.com/products/javahelp/index.html">http://java.sun.com/products/javahelp/index.html</a> |
| </li> |
| <li><b>Apache Ant 1.6.x</b> - כלי build מבוסס Java שמערכת ה-build של NetBeans תלויה בו. <a href="http://ant.apache.org/">http://ant.apache.org/</a> |
| </li> |
| <li><b>JUnit 3.8.x</b> - מסגרת בדיקה המשמשת להרצת בדיקות יחידה ב-NetBeans. <a href="http://www.junit.org/index.html">http://www.junit.org/index.html</a></li> |
| <li><span style="font-weight: bold;">Tomcat 5.x.x</span> - servlet container משובץ לפיתוח Java Servlet ו-JSP. <a |
| href="http://jakarta.apache.org/tomcat/index.html">http://jakarta.apache.org/tomcat/index.html</a></li> |
| <li><span style="font-weight: bold;">JSP Standard Tag Library (JSTL)</span> |
| - <a href="http://java.sun.com/products/jsp/jstl/">http://java.sun.com/products/jsp/jstl/</a></li> |
| </ul> |
| <p>מהדורה נתונה של NetBeans יכולה לכלול בתוכה קבצים רבים או מעטים יותר ללא רישוי CDDL. כדי להיות בטוח, ברר <a href="../lists/top.html">ברשימהnbdev </a>. |
| </p> |
| <h2>תרומה</h2> |
| <br> |
| עיין ב<a href="../contribute/index_he.html">דף לקחת חלק</a>. |
| </body> |
| </html> |